Chocolate Almond Dream
After making fresh almond butter, my Vita-Mix was a little more difficult to clean than usual because right down under the blade was a few tablespoons of unreachable almond butter. Luckily, it was also time for dessert, so I added 1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der, a sprinkle of cinnamon, 1/4 cup maple syrup, and 2 cups plain rice milk. I blended up the best.drink.ever.

Chocolate Dream Smoothie
As with all of my Vita-Mix smoothies, throw all of the ingredients in, turn to speed 10, then high, then enjoy.
Ingredients:
- 2 cups plain rice milk
- 2 oz unsweetened chocolate
- 1/4 cup maple syrup
- 1/2 cup shelled walnuts
